Understanding IPTV Operation



IP Television, or IPTV, broadcasts television content over conventional internet protocol (IP) networks. Essentially, IPTV relies on the existing system to send video, audio, and interactive services directly to viewers' devices. This approach facilitates a dynamic viewing experience with features like on-demand content, tailored playlists, and time-shifting capabilities.


The IPTV system typically consists of several key components: a content provider who acquires television programming, a headend that packages the content into suitable IP formats, a network infrastructure for routing the data, and finally, set-top boxes or other compatible devices at the viewer's end.

IPTV Business Models: Revenue Streams and Strategies



The dynamic world of IPTV offers a multitude of revenue generating models for service providers to explore. These models leverage various methods to generate revenue. One common model involves monthly payments, where users pay a recurring fee for access to content. Another popular approach is display ads, where IPTV platforms display ads to viewers, generating income based on impressions or clicks. package deals can also be a lucrative strategy, combining IPTV with other products such as internet access, phone lines, or cloud storage. Ultimately, the viability of an IPTV business model depends on factors like target audience, content library, and market competition.

IPTV and OTT: A Comparison

In the rapidly evolving world of television streaming, understanding the distinctions between IPTV and OTT is essential. Both offer a plethora of content options, but their underlying technologies and delivery mechanisms differ significantly. IPTV stands for Internet Protocol Television and involves delivering television content over internet infrastructure. It often relies on traditional cable or telecom providers to broadcast signals to subscribers. Conversely, OTT (Over-the-Top) encompasses any service that streams content directly to viewers via the internet, bypassing traditional broadcast methods. This enables a wider array of content providers, including Netflix, Hulu, and Amazon Prime Video, to reach audiences directly.
